About LocalMotion
LocalMotion is a UK-wide network of place-based partnerships to combat the root causes of social, environmental, and economic inequality with networks in Lincoln, Enfield, Torbay, Oldham, and Middlesbrough. Carmarthen is the only Wales-based location.
LocalMotion Carmarthen is working to explore these themes through a cultural methodology. We are a social justice movement based around democratising and empowering approaches to community development. We see culture as a critical tool in which to model and design change, seed collaboration, and speak truth to power.

Our program in Carmarthen is rooted around two systems of governance, the Local Peoples Assembly, made up of 13 local people with lived experiences, and our Core Group. We also have an extensive network of local partners, a public program, and local think tanks exploring and researching different areas of social economic infrastructure. Our activities are broad and varied, taking many different forms, from providing training, to gardening, to a community feast, or even publishing reports, making proposals, hosting events and symposiums, or even a street play workshop.

LocalMotion Carmarthen is hosted by People Speak Up.

You will be employed and contracted by People Speak Up.
